Transaction 4d61daf405bc4f58eea281c27e3d60a0a2d3d61b75cc5a373cf5d36f99e5d59a
1 Input
1 Output
-
4d61daf405bc4f58eea281c27e3d60a0a2d3d61b75cc5a373cf5d36f99e5d59a:0
- value
- 839435
- script pubkey
- OP_0 OP_PUSHBYTES_20 e734028cb464c70ed1716fcd223c890c32665a11
- address
- bc1quu6q9r95vnrsa5t3dlxjy0yfpsexvks38m5lxg